I currently hold an Pevensey Bay - Pevensey & Westham Annual Season, purchased solely to obtain the benefits of a Gold Card.
My usual journey to work is cheaper over the course of a year by buying tickets on a daily basis (with the 1/3rd discount) versus buying an Annual Season for the actual journeys I make.
This is because I always travel just after 09:30 and benefit from off-peak fares.
Next week, however, I have to attend work earlier and can only get there on time if I travel before 09:00, so can’t get the Gold Card discount.
5 return tickets next week would cost £159, whereas a 7-day season comes to £125.20.
Can I hold two season tickets concurrently? If so, can I use the same photocard?
